Plot Summary
In a world where humans can escape reality by entering a fantastical realm, a writer is tasked with killing a character from another world to prevent a catastrophic war. However, when he encounters the character, he finds himself in a moral dilemma, questioning the true nature of reality and his own existence.
Critical Reception
A Writer's Odyssey was a visually ambitious film that blended high-octane action with philosophical themes. While praised for its special effects and creative world-building, it received mixed reviews for its complex narrative and uneven pacing.
What Reviewers Say
- Praised for its stunning visual effects and imaginative concept.
- Criticized for a convoluted plot that may alienate some viewers.
- The action sequences are thrilling, but the narrative struggles to maintain coherence.
Google audience: Audiences were divided, with many appreciating the film's visual spectacle and unique premise, while others found the story difficult to follow and emotionally distant.
